Requirements

  • High level of ownership, accountability, and initiative
  • Ability to identify opportunities that benefit the customer and build solutions that meet customers’ expectations, including resolving issues
  • Ability to quickly adapt to new initiatives, concepts, and services within the store
  • Proven success in working in a fast-paced environment with the ability to multi-task
  • Ability to frequently lift and carry up to 25 pounds and occasionally up to 50 pounds
  • Basic understanding of technology tools and computer applications such as Microsoft Outlook, Excel, and more
  • Physical ability for continuous movement 6-8 hours per shift, including frequent bending, twisting, squatting, flexing, reaching, grasping, fine manipulation, pushing, pulling, and handling bulky/awkwardly shaped items (regularly up to 10 pounds, occasionally up to 25 pounds)

Responsibilities

  • Assist managers with daily operations of the store to maximize sales and maintain operational standards
  • Support team of employees to ensure operational tasks, procedures, opening, and closing routines are completed successfully, keeping the customer at the center
  • Lead by example by setting and exceeding personal and company goals while emphasizing outstanding customer service
  • Support employees to deliver outstanding customer service by teaching and training
  • Share knowledge of fashion, upcoming events, Nordstrom gift cards, Nordstrom Rewards program, and mailing list with customers
  • Assist in maintaining selling floors and stockrooms organized and clean
  • Complete all inventory processes, ensuring merchandise is properly checked in and accurately ticketed

About Nordstrom

Nordstrom is a retail company that focuses on providing a wide range of clothing, shoes, and accessories for men, women, and children. The company operates department stores and an online platform where customers can shop for various brands and styles. Nordstrom emphasizes a strong customer service experience, encouraging employees to take initiative and develop their careers within the organization. Unlike many competitors, Nordstrom fosters a culture of leadership and personal growth among its staff, which contributes to a dedicated and motivated workforce. The company's goal is to create a positive shopping experience while also being committed to environmental sustainability and community support.
